I would like to try something I just found out about this year. Yeah sometimes I think I've lived in a cave! It's calling Boo'ing. 
I love this concept! You get a treat bag or basket together, fill it with all kinds of fun treats and surprises for the boo'ee. You include the following:
The air is cool, the season fall,
Soon Halloween will come to all.

Ghosts and goblins, spooks galore...
Tricky witches at your door.
The spooks are after things to do,
In fact a spook brought this "Boo" to you!
The excitement comes when friends like you,
Copy this note and make it two.
We'll all have smiles upon our faces,
No one will know who "BOO"ed who's places!
Just two short days to work your spell,
Keep it secret, hide it well.
Please join the fun, the seasons here .
Just spread these "BOO's" and Halloween cheer.

Include a sheet of paper that says:
You have been BOOED! Please keep it going by following these directions:

  1. Enjoy your treat
  2. Place the BOO sign on your front door or visible in a window
  3. Within 2 days, make 2 copies of this note, make 2 treats & 2 BOO signs
  4. Secretly deliver to 2 neighbors/friends without a BOO.
  5. Keep an eye on nearby front doors to see how far and fast it spreads by Halloween.
